## What is a wire transfer?

The wire transfer meaning in banking is ‘a method of sending money electronically between two accounts within the country or abroad’. In other words, it’s a transfer to any bank without cash being involved.

Sounds exactly like traditional bank transfers, right? Not quite so — wire transfer meaning in banking has its own specifics. ‘Money wire transfers’ refer to remittances managed through networks like SWIFT or Fedwire. Meanwhile, ‘bank transfers’ mean domestic payments through local networks like SEPA in Europe. To you, as a customer, it results in differences in processing times, costs, and available destinations.

## How does a wire transfer work?

Here’s how to send a wire transfer step-by-step:

1.  Visit a branch or find the ‘money wire transfer’ section in your bank’s app.
2.  Check what information is needed for a wire transfer and enter it.
3.  Add the transfer amount.
4.  Pay the fees.
5.  Confirm. Depending on the bank, you might also get a tracking number or confirmation message so you can follow the transfer.

## What information is needed for a wire transfer

It depends on whether you send money within the country or abroad.

Piece of information

Domestic bank wire transfers

International bank wire transfers

Recipient full name

Yes

Yes

Recipient address

Sometimes required

Yes

Recipient bank name and address

Yes

Yes

Recipient bank account number

Yes

Yes, or IBAN

Bank routing number (ABA/RTN)

Yes

No

SWIFT/BIC code

No

Yes

[IBAN (International Bank Account Number)](https://www.profee.com/articles/what-is-an-iban)

No

Yes

Currency amount and type

Yes

Yes

Sender full name

Yes

Yes

Sender address

Sometimes required

Often required

Phone numbers (sender and recipient)

Sometimes required

Often required

Purpose of transfer

Sometimes required

Often required

Information needed for international money transfers is usually more detailed because moving funds across countries requires extra verification.

## Are wire transfers the best choice?

Money wire transfers look simple and convenient, but there are several cons you should be aware of.

*   **High fees.** In some cases, you might pay as much as 50 EUR — or even more — just to send a single transfer. That’s a serious hit to your wallet.
*   **Extra paperwork.** Banks often ask for additional information needed for international money transfers, which can slow things down and add unnecessary stress.
*   **Unstable rates.** Since exchange rates usually aren’t locked in, the final amount your recipient gets may be less than expected. For anyone careful with money, that’s incredibly frustrating.
*   **Lengthy waiting times.** Some transfers can take several days to complete, and not everyone is willing to wait or deal with the stress that comes with delays.

### What are the risks of wire transfers?

You can’t get your money back if you accidentally send it to the wrong person. You can also be involved in fraud if you don’t verify the recipient carefully. ### How long does a wire transfer take?

From minutes to several days. It can be delayed during weekends and bank holidays.

### How does a wire transfer work?

You send money directly from one account to another through global transfer networks like SWIFT.

### Is PayPal a wire transfer?

No, it’s a digital platform for remittances and money management. However, you can initiate a wire transfer through PayPal.
